The function f(z) is defined for z in [1, 6]. We want to find x such that
z = 3(x -2)
Substituting the interval for z, we have
[1, 6] = 3(x -2)
[1/3, 2] = x -2 . . . . divide by 3
[2 1/3, 4] = x . . . .. add 2
The domain of f(3(x -2)) is ...
2 1/3 ≤ x ≤ 4.
